    Overview

    Available are 9 tracts of land, each zoned agricultural and ranging from 5.2 to 6.4 acres, suitable for homesteading. These tracts are part of a community focused on sustainable living, including growing food and raising animals using permaculture and agroforestry techniques, with the aim of reducing dependence on municipal utilities. The sellers, who reside in the community, offer assistance with projects, providing access to a machine shop, sawmill, and heavy equipment for building structures and land clearing. The tracts vary, offering features like a weather stream, pond, and mountain views, all ensuring privacy. Each tract is accessible via common roads and private driveways with graded bar ditches and culverts. Most have a house seat already cut in. Located approximately 30 minutes from Greeneville and Morristown, and about an hour from Knoxville, Pigeon Forge, and Gatlinburg, the property is near shopping, restaurants, and a hospital in Newport. Tract 6, situated on Topaz Road, features a hilltop home site with potential eastern views and a south-facing slope suitable for gardening. The gently sloping ridgetop has cleared space, making it possible to create 2-3 acres of level ground. It is approximately 1400 feet from the central well, 1000 feet from the nearest electric pole, and 1600 feet from the nearest known city water tap, with 50 feet of public road frontage on Looney Road. Public water may be available on Looney Road.
